Busilet is a reference implementation of IDTP and UTID.
...The IDTP (Identifier Tracing Protocol) is a communication protocol to access the information of a thing that identified by UTID. The IDTP and UTID were designed by the author of the Busilet project in recent three years. For more information, see:

Project Busilet is a reference implementation of IDTP that provides a set of APIs developers to develop IDTP server and IDTP client software. Busilet4j is written in Java language and is for Java programmer to develop IDTP server and IDTP client software.

Doc Beep is a high performance implementation of the BEEP messaging protocol framework (RFC3080, RFC3081) in both C++ and Java. DocBeep also includes modeling tools to portably support development, deployment, and configuration of BEEP applications.
